Star-shaped PMMA-b-PS block copolymers with POSS core were prepared by atom transfer radical polymerization of St using star-shaped POSS/PMMA-Cl as a macroinitiator in presence of CuCl, 2,2,-bipyridine, toluene at 110 °C. The core-first method, which used an active multifunctional core to initiate the growth of polymer chains, was applicable to making star-shaped block copolymers with POSS core. The structure of hybrid star-shaped PMMA-b-PS block copolymers was characterized by GPC and 1H NMR, respectively.
